Sound Transmission Class STC is an integer rating of how well a building partition attenuates airborne sound. Sound Transmission Class STC is used to measure a building materials ability to reduce sound. The method of measuring the sound transmission class STC is defined by the ASTM E413-87 standard.

STC accounts for sound measured between 125 Hz to 4000 Hz. The higher the STC rating the more efficient the construction will be in reducing sound transmission within the frequency range of the test. Sound Transmission Class STC is a single number rating system which assigns a value to a product to indicate how well that product insulates against unwanted noise within the frequency range of speech 125-4000 Hz. International Building Code requires 50 STC between adjacent dwelling units.

Sound Transmission Class STC is a single-number rating of the airborne sound transmission loss TL performance of a constructed assembly measured at standard one-third octave band frequencies. The Sound Transmission Class STC ratings of various construction elements are of considerable interest to architects and acoustical engineers.

In the USA it is widely used to rate interior partitions ceilings and floors doors windows and exterior wall configurations see ASTM International Classification E413 and E90.
